Buffalo Check Embossed Background: Rooted in Nature

Good afternoon!  Today I'm continuing to share ideas using the fabulous Buffalo Check stamp set and after yesterday where we stamped snowflakes on top of the check I was trying to figure out what else we could do, so I thought, how about embossing?  I also decided to take a bit more organic look and feel to the card and absolutely love the end result.

For this card I used Crumb Cake cardstock for the cardbase and then added Tranquil Tide cardstock as the mat for the cardfront.  To make the cardfront I started with Mint Macaron cardstock and stamped with the Buffalo Check stamp set using Tranquil Tide ink.  Next I used the Big Shot and Swirls and Curls Embossing Folder to emboss the cardfront and sponged using Crumb Cake ink to help distress the image and make the swirls really pop.  The designer series paper is from the Nature's Poem DSP package and I lightly sponged on it as well with Crumb Cake ink to "dirty it up" and then wrapped a piece of Tranquil Tide 3/8" Mini Ruffled Ribbon to hide the border.


For the stamped image I used the Rooted in Nature stamp set and stamped the large stump image on Crumb Cake cardstock with Crumb cake ink and then cut it out freehand with my Paper Snips.  The greeting is from the same stamp set and was stamped in Rich Razzleberry ink and accented with several pearls I lined up in a row.  I used the leaf dies (both cutting and embossing) from the Nature's Roots Framelits to cut the leaf out of Rich Razzleberry cardstock and sponged it before attaching it behind the greeting which was raised up with dimensionals.
